Frequency of sarcopenia in diabetic and non-diabetic chronic kidney patients using bioempedance analysis and comparison with the normal popülation

Abstract (EN)

Introduction and Purpose: Sarcopenia is a disease area that has become increasingly important both in the world and in Turkey in recent years. Since there are not many studies comparing diabetic and non-diabetic chronic kidney disease (CKD) and normal population with the bioimpedance analysis (BIA) method, it is aimed to contribute to the literature on this subject and to increase awareness of sarcopenia with the results obtained and to benefit the follow-up of patients. Materials and Methods: The study included 60 diabetic CKD, 60 non-diabetic CKD and 60 control patients without chronic disease, who were over 40 years old and applied to Manisa Celal Bayar University Hafsa Sultan Hospital Nephrology and Endocrinology Polyclinic. There were 30 female and 30 male participants in each group. In addition to recording the laboratory parameters of the patients, anthropometric measurements, hand grip strength test with dynamometer, SARC-F survey, BIA measurement and TUG test were performed. Results: Sarcopenia was detected in 22 (12.2%) of the patients. In the patient groups, sarcopenia was detected in 14 (23.3%) patients with diabetic CKD, 7 (11.7%) patients in non-diabetic CKD and 1 (1.7%) patient in the control group, and a statistically significant difference was found between the groups. Used to evaluate muscle strength and quality between groups; While handgrip strength (ESG) and skeletal muscle quality (ESG/SCC) values were found to be significantly lower in the diabetic CKD group compared to other groups, SARC-F score and TUG test were found to be significantly higher in the diabetic CKD group compared to other groups. In subgroup analyses, while this significance continued in women, it was observed that it lost statistical significance in men, except for the TUG test. Correlation analyzes showed that skeletal muscle quality and spot urine protein/creatinine ratio were inversely proportional. It was observed that GFR was inversely proportional with the TUG test. Conclusion: Our study showed that muscle strength, muscle mass, muscle function and muscle quality were lower in diabetic CKD patients than in non-diabetic CKD patients and the control group without chronic disease. It has been determined that muscle function and muscle quality decrease with the decrease in GFR and increase in proteinuria. In diabetic patients, it has been shown that muscle function and muscle quality decrease as fasting blood glucose and HbA1c increase.
